How Crypto Payout Systems Work in Practice

At a high level, a crypto payout flow starts when a business approves a disbursement and sends value to a user’s wallet address. In practice, the system behind that transfer is much more layered. There are wallet checks, chain selection, compliance controls, asset conversion rules, treasury safeguards, reconciliation logic, and support workflows.

Most business-grade setups use one of three models: direct wallet payouts from treasury, payouts through a payment processor, or hybrid models where the processor handles on-chain delivery while the business keeps policy control. Stablecoins are often preferred because they reduce the accounting and customer service complexity associated with volatile assets.

A strong payout architecture usually includes the following elements:

  • User wallet collection and verification
  • Asset and network selection, such as USDT on Tron or USDC on Ethereum-compatible rails
  • Risk screening, sanctions checks, and transaction monitoring
  • Approval rules based on amount, geography, and account history
  • Treasury management, including fiat-to-crypto conversion if needed
  • Automated reconciliation for finance teams
  • Support escalation for failed, delayed, or misrouted transfers
Pro Tip: For most operators, the first strategic decision is not “Which coin should we use?” It is “Which stablecoin and which network create the best balance of liquidity, user familiarity, compliance support, and predictable transaction costs?”

One mistake I see often is treating wallet collection as a simple checkout field. It is not. A payout can be technically fast and still create support chaos if users pick the wrong network, submit exchange deposit addresses with restrictions, or misunderstand minimum balance requirements. The best programs reduce preventable error before the transaction is ever sent.

Use Cases Where Crypto Payouts Outperform Legacy Methods

Crypto payouts are not automatically better than bank transfers or cards. They are better in specific conditions. Those conditions tend to involve urgency, geographic reach, user preference, or payout fragmentation.

For gaming operators, affiliate platforms, marketplaces, creator economies, and digital service businesses, the strongest use cases usually include rapid user withdrawals, partner commissions, VIP settlements, rebates, tournament winnings, and cross-border vendor payments. In these situations, fast access to funds is part of the product experience.

In one project I worked on with iGaming Payment, an operator had users spread across several regions where bank transfer reliability varied sharply by country. Withdrawal complaints were rising, not because the operator lacked funds, but because local settlement paths were inconsistent. We helped the team add stablecoin payouts as an optional rail, paired with stricter wallet validation and clear network labeling. Within the first operating cycle, support tickets related to “Where is my withdrawal?” dropped noticeably, and high-value users began selecting the new method at a much higher rate than expected.

That case taught us something simple but important: users do not just want speed. They want predictability. A payout method becomes valuable when customers understand how long it usually takes, what fees to expect, and how to use it without friction.

How Different Payout Models Compare

Not every brand should run the same crypto payout structure. The right setup depends on volume, regulatory footprint, treasury sophistication, and whether the business wants direct custody exposure.

Business Scenario Best-Fit Payout Model Main Advantage Main Trade-Off
Global iGaming operator with high withdrawal volume Processor-led stablecoin payouts Scalable automation and compliance tooling Third-party dependency and service fees
Affiliate network paying partners in multiple countries Hybrid processor plus internal approval controls Flexible workflows with faster settlement More integration and policy design work
Digital marketplace with crypto-native user base Direct treasury wallet payouts Maximum control and lower intermediary cost Higher custody and operational burden
Mid-size SaaS platform paying remote contractors Stablecoin payouts via treasury partner Predictable cross-border settlement Need for contractor wallet education

If your finance team is early in its crypto maturity curve, processor-led models usually create the safest starting point. If your business already manages digital asset treasury operations internally, direct models may lower long-term cost and give you tighter control over liquidity timing.

Business Benefits That Actually Matter

Marketing around crypto payments often overstates the upside. The real value tends to be more practical than dramatic. When crypto payouts work well, they improve a handful of operating metrics that executives actually care about.

Settlement Speed

Instead of waiting for batch windows, bank cutoffs, or intermediary bank processing, businesses can initiate payouts around the clock. That is especially useful for industries where customer trust is closely tied to withdrawal speed.

Cross-Border Reach

Crypto rails do not erase regulation, but they can reduce the mechanical friction of moving value internationally. That makes them attractive for companies with distributed users, contractors, and partners.

Fee Visibility

Costs are not always lower, but they are often easier to model. Businesses can compare processor charges, network fees, conversion spreads, and internal labor against the hidden complexity of correspondent banking and failed legacy transfers.

User Choice

Optionality matters. A crypto rail should not replace every existing payout method. It should sit alongside cards, bank transfers, and e-wallets where user preference data supports it.

Risks, Compliance, and Operational Constraints

Crypto payouts are not a free pass around regulation or risk management. They create a different risk profile, and mature businesses treat that reality seriously.

The first challenge is compliance. Depending on the jurisdiction, a business may need to address licensing requirements, sanctions screening, anti-money laundering controls, source-of-funds questions, tax reporting, and travel rule considerations. A payout option that works in one market may be restricted, impractical, or closely supervised in another.

The second challenge is operational finality. On-chain transfers are often irreversible. If funds are sent to the wrong address or through the wrong network, recovery may be impossible. That demands stronger front-end controls than many legacy payout systems require.

The third challenge is treasury and accounting. If payouts are made in volatile assets, balance sheet exposure becomes a real issue. Even with stablecoins, businesses need policies for conversion timing, reserve asset quality, liquidity providers, and reconciliation across on-chain and fiat systems.

There is also a customer education issue. Some users understand wallets deeply. Others do not know the difference between a token, a chain, and an address format. If your support team is not trained, fast settlement can still produce a poor experience.

A Practical Rollout Framework for Operators and Platforms

If you are evaluating crypto payouts, the best approach is controlled expansion rather than full replacement of existing rails. Start narrow, gather data, and refine quickly.

  1. Map the payout pain point. Identify where legacy methods are failing by geography, user segment, transaction size, or timing.
  2. Choose the asset and network policy. Stablecoins are usually the first choice for predictable business use. Limit networks at launch to reduce confusion.
  3. Define your compliance perimeter. Confirm jurisdictional limits, screening requirements, recordkeeping standards, and processor obligations.
  4. Design wallet validation and user prompts. Use confirmation steps, network warnings, and plain-English instructions before approval.
  5. Run a pilot cohort. Start with a clearly defined group such as affiliates, VIP users, or one market with known demand.
  6. Measure operational outcomes. Track adoption, payout time, failure rates, support tickets, and cost per successful transaction.
  7. Expand based on evidence. Add markets, assets, or transaction types only when controls and support are ready.

This staged approach protects both user experience and internal teams. It also creates the reporting structure leadership needs before approving larger treasury or infrastructure commitments.

Lessons From the Field at iGaming Payment

One of the most useful lessons I have learned at iGaming Payment is that the winning payout experience is usually boring in the best way. Users should not need to think hard. They should know what asset they are receiving, what network they must use, how long settlement usually takes, and where to get help if something looks wrong.

In another engagement, we worked with a platform that wanted to push crypto payouts aggressively because its competitors were marketing “instant withdrawals.” On paper, that looked smart. In practice, the user base was split. Some customers were crypto-native, while others barely understood wallet custody. We advised a segmented launch: stablecoin payouts as an opt-in for experienced users, traditional methods preserved for everyone else, and educational prompts added before every first withdrawal. That decision reduced avoidable mistakes and kept support volume manageable.

Personally, I think this is where many providers miss the mark. They talk about speed as if speed alone solves the whole problem. It does not. The better metric is trusted access to funds. A five-minute payout that creates panic is worse than a thirty-minute payout that users understand and can verify.

What are crypto payouts in business terms?
  • Crypto payouts are payments sent to recipients through blockchain-based assets instead of, or alongside, bank transfers and card rails. Businesses commonly use them for customer withdrawals, affiliate commissions, contractor payments, and cross-border settlements where speed and flexibility matter.

Are stablecoins better than Bitcoin for payouts?
  • For most business payout programs, yes. Stablecoins such as USDT or USDC are usually easier to price, reconcile, and explain to users because they are designed to maintain a more stable value than assets like Bitcoin. Bitcoin can still be offered where user demand is strong, but it creates more volatility exposure.

Are crypto payouts always faster than bank transfers?
  • Often, but not automatically. Speed depends on the chosen blockchain, the processor, approval workflows, and whether the user submitted the correct wallet information. Crypto rails can settle much faster than many traditional methods, especially across borders, but a weak operational setup can still cause delays.

What is the biggest risk in crypto payouts?
  • The biggest risk is usually operational error combined with weak controls. Sending funds to the wrong address, approving transactions without adequate screening, or offering too many networks too early can create losses and support issues quickly. Good policy design matters as much as the technology itself.

How should a company start offering crypto payouts?
  • Start with a limited pilot. Most businesses should begin by selecting one or two stablecoins, limiting supported networks, defining compliance rules, and testing the flow with a narrow user segment such as affiliates or VIP customers. Measure adoption, failures, support volume, and settlement time before scaling further.
